    My dentist has always asked to see my exemption card when I have been for appointments since I informed them I am pregnant.

    I am having real problems as I have developed a pregnancy tumour on my gum. It basically means the gum is enlarged and has grown downwards between the two teeth :( it bleeds really badly when I brush sometimes for up to 15 minutes at a time. I mentioned it to the dentist last week as had an appointment and he said they don't like to do anything about them as if they remove them they can grow back more quickly than they first appeared. It's because of the increased hormones and blood flow to the gum. He gave me some Corsodyl mouthwash on prescription, told me to use it for a week then have three weeks off using it. It has helped a bit but on certain days it still bleeds badly.

    I might have to go back as he said he can give me some antibiotics for it if I need them. Trust me to get something like that!
